Our target audience for music video is a niche audience; our artist is an independent artist so the amount of people who are familiar with him will be low. The audience we are aiming at are female and male, aged between 16 to 22. Our target audience means that we will be looking to please the younger generation who live mainly in and around London. The ethnic background of our audience would be from White, Asian, Black and any other our artist doesn't really portray a favorite in his music. Also our audience would mainly be students or young people in part time of full time work. The type of transport they take would mainly be public, so the bus, train or tube. it would also be played in these places because the music is relaxing and the person can enjoy it while they are going from A to B. The type of reading material they would be into is mainly fiction; they would also probably read a lot of music blogs on the internet and music magazines. They would mostly be in contact with other friends on BBM, Twitter, Facebook and any other type of social networking. The type of clothing they would wear would mainly be new and funky so for example Dope Chef, Vans and Obey. They would be called 'Hipsters'. They would shop at H&M, Size and at Brick Lane. Other types of music they would listen to would be Jazz, RnB, and Conscious Hip-Hop.

The music video would follow, Andrew Goodwin's theory because most of it would be based on performance in various ways and there wont be a narrative and no clear meaning would be added. So it follows the style of disjuncture. This would appeal to the audience because the video would be constantly moving maintaining the audiences interests.

The locations such as brick lane, clothing, how they present themselves but within the music video weird things such as masks, use of lens such as fish eye we have found one and are going to use.

We are filming in a number of various locations such as Brick Lane because Brick Lane is quite a colorful area and it reflects the tone of the song, we will be filming in a recording studio because it highlights the effort of the artist. We will also be filming in Hampstead Heath, Chinatown, A skate park in Mile End and in Camden Town.

We chose this song because we want to create an original music video. We decided to ask The Annoying Wanderer if we could help him produce a music video for his track. This is the first video to the song Mad Meditations so there is not an original video, however this allows us to be as creative as we want with the planning and production of the music video.

As a group we decided to focus on visual street art and color, it is important for us to depict the hipster vision into our music video.

We will be filming in a lot of locations for the music video so we have to be incredibly aware of surroundings so we as a group need to make sure that the technical equipment are safe and no in danger of any damages.

We will be filming most of the time in busy streets where there will be a lot of people so we need to make sure that none of the filming equipment gets lost or stolen. This is really important for us because we are held responsible if anything happens to them. Also the group has to be aware that while filming on the streets no one knocks over the camera and damages that.

Lastly the weather could be another contributing factor which may cause damage. So it is important to check the weather before filming and in case it does rain we need to make sure that that they are protected to minimise damage.

The Annoying Wanderer is a hipster who is represents urban London. What is interesting about this artist is that he's not like the conventional rap artist. Our artist will be similar to other rappers in his genre like Lecs Luther and SGP. They are not mainstream artists because they cater to a niche audience who are mainly London based.

The Annoying Wanderer would wear snap back hats and tank tops, and bold, statement pieces and he is interested in fashion and the new cool trends . If we compared his style to currents artist it would be with Rizzle Kicks, and brands he would wear is OBEY, VANS, vintage clothes, supreme etc.
